[Treatment of aneurysmal bone cyst]

Summary
Surgical treatment effectively managed aneurysmal bone cysts (ABCs) in pediatric patients. Most cases involved aggressive or active cysts, with curettage and bone grafting leading to successful outcomes in 15 of 16 patients.

Background:
- Aneurysmal bone cysts (ABCs) are benign, expansile, osteolytic bone lesions.
- These lesions can be locally aggressive and pose a surgical challenge, particularly in pediatric populations.
- Accurate classification (e.g., Capanna classification) is crucial for treatment planning.
Purpose of the Study:
- To evaluate the surgical treatment outcomes for aneurysmal bone cysts (ABCs) in pediatric patients.
- To analyze the efficacy of different surgical techniques, including curettage, bone grafting, and en-bloc resection.
- To assess the recurrence and complication rates associated with ABC management.
Main Methods:
- Retrospective analysis of 16 pediatric patients treated for ABCs between 1998 and 2000.
- Surgical interventions included curettage with bone grafting (autograft, allograft, or combined), en-bloc resection, and radiotherapy.
- Patient demographics, cyst characteristics (aggressive/active), surgical procedures, and outcomes were recorded.
Main Results:
- The study included 16 patients aged 5-15 years, with 12 aggressive and 5 active cysts.
- Curettage with bone grafting was performed in 12 cases, utilizing various graft types (autograft, allograft, combined).
- Successful surgical management was achieved in 15 out of 16 cases, with one revision procedure required.
Conclusions:
- Surgical treatment, primarily curettage with bone grafting, is highly effective for pediatric aneurysmal bone cysts.
- The choice of bone graft material (autograft vs. allograft) may influence outcomes, though both can be successful.
- Aggressive and active ABCs can be managed effectively, with a low rate of revision surgery.
